数据库原理模拟试题解析

需积分: 3 1 下载量 142 浏览量 更新于2024-07-23 收藏 184KB DOC 举报
"数据库原理模拟试卷《集》包含多项选择题和填空题,涵盖了数据库系统的基本概念、数据模型、关系数据库、并发控制、数据库保护、规范化理论等多个方面的知识。" 详细知识点说明: 1. 数据库系统的体系结构通常指的是三级模式结构(外模式、模式、内模式)和两级映象(外模式/模式映象和模式/内模式映象),这是数据库设计的基础。 2. SQL语言是Structured Query Language的缩写,是用于管理和处理关系数据库的标准语言,主要功能包括数据查询、数据操纵、数据定义和数据控制。 3. 视图是数据库的一个虚拟表,可以从一个或多个基本表中获取数据。视图上可以进行查询操作,但不能直接用于插入、更新或删除数据,除非这些操作可以被安全地传播到基表。 4. 并发操作可能导致的问题包括死锁、丢失更新、读脏数据和不可重复读,这些问题需要通过事务管理、锁定机制等手段来解决。 5. 关系模型是目前应用最广泛的数据模型,其核心是关系,即二维表格形式的数据表示。 6. 在关系模式中,如果同一本书允许一个读者多次借阅,但不能同时借多本,那么主键应该是组合键,包括书号、读者号和借期,以确保唯一性。 7. 为了实现物理数据独立性,需要修改的是模式与内模式的映射,这样更改数据存储方式不会影响到应用程序。 8. 数据库的主要特点包括数据共享、数据完整性和数据冗余较小,而数据独立性低不是数据库的特点,相反,数据库设计的目标是提高数据独立性。 9. 数据库存储的不仅是数据本身,还包括数据之间的联系,形成一个有组织的数据集合。 10. E-R模型(实体-关系模型)是反映现实世界中实体及实体间联系的信息模型,用于数据库设计的早期阶段。 11. 基本的关系代数运算包括并(∪)、差(-)、笛卡尔积(×)、选择(σ)和投影(π)。 12. 数据库保护通常包括完整性保护、并发控制和故障恢复,而不包括控制数据冗余,冗余控制是数据库设计中的一个目标,用来减少冗余和提高数据一致性。 13. 第三范式(3NF)是关系规范化的一个较高层次,它要求消除非主属性对候选键的部分依赖和传递依赖。 14. 外模式是单个用户或应用程序看到的数据视图,反映了数据库的局部逻辑结构。 15. 子模式DDL(Data Definition Language)用于描述数据库的局部逻辑结构,如用户视图或特定用户的访问权限。 以上内容是试卷中涉及的数据库原理的关键知识点,包括数据库系统结构、SQL、视图操作、并发控制、数据库设计、数据模型、规范化理论和数据库保护等方面。这些知识对于理解和操作数据库至关重要。
手机看
程序员都在用的中文IT技术交流社区

程序员都在用的中文IT技术交流社区

专业的中文 IT 技术社区,与千万技术人共成长

专业的中文 IT 技术社区,与千万技术人共成长

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

客服 返回
顶部